Because many types of insulation like loose fill and batts work by trapping air leaky walls roofs and floors mean poor thermal performance.
Always use unfaced batts both when laying product for the first time and to prevent moisture from becoming trapped between new and old layers of insulation.
Once the foam has dried fiberglass batt insulation can then be installed to fill in the rest of the cavity.
